Picture credit score: CineDCurrent eND merchandise availableKipperTie’s LCminiND is a drop-in digital ND cartridge for the Canon RF-to-EF adapter customary and appropriate mounts. It presents repeatedly variable ND from 0.6 to 2.1 (about 2–7 stops) with on-device management and Bluetooth app help for distant adjustment and clean ND ramps. A transparent insert will be swapped in when no ND is required.KipperTie x LC-Tec eND. Picture credit score: CineDMatte field model is comingLC-Tec has additionally been growing a sq. 4×5.65-inch digital ND to be used in a matte field. Earlier showings demonstrated repeatedly adjustable density in a regular tray, managed from a small exterior unit. KipperTie and LC-Tec informed us at IBC {that a} matte-box model is in energetic growth, with pricing nonetheless being finalized.Matte Field is coming! In any case, who doesn’t need a slim, stepless ND filter in-camera lately?eND is simply a part of the gameAlongside ND, LC-Tec develops Digital Variable Diffusion (eVD) and Star filters, shifting towards mass manufacturing after showcasing some prototypes.At this level, it’s a 4×5.65-inch matte-box filter whose diffusion power will be adjusted electronically, enabling repeatable in-shot adjustments that beforehand required swapping glass. Based on LC-Tec, it’s potential to stack eND and eVD filters into one single product, however it gained’t essentially be commercially viable. Additionally, keep in mind that digital filters can’t “xero” the impact, so you might need to separate them, so that you gained’t have a minimal of -2.0 stops glued to your variable diffusion filter, and vice versa.Exact and repeatable app management.
